Abstract EN

Consider a sequence of positive integers in arithmetic progression uk=u0+kr with (u0,r)=1.

Denote the least common multiple of u0,…,un by Ln.

We show that if n⩾r2+r, then Ln⩾u0rr+1r+1, and we obtain optimum result on n in some cases for such estimate.

Besides, for quadratic sequences m2+c,m+12+c,…,n2+c, we also show that the least common multiple is at least 2n when m⩽n/2, which sharpens a recent result of Farhi.
